Identifying Signs of Infestation:
Early detection is key to preventing pest and termite damage from escalating. We’ll explore common signs of infestation to watch for, from droppings and gnaw marks to mud tubes and discarded wings. By recognizing these indicators early on, homeowners can take swift action to address the problem before it becomes more extensive and costly to resolve.
Integrated Pest Management (IPM):
Integrated Pest Management (IPM) is a holistic approach to pest control Perth that combines multiple strategies to achieve long-term solutions. We’ll delve into the principles of IPM, which include prevention, monitoring, and targeted interventions tailored to specific pest challenges. From sealing entry points to implementing cultural controls and using least-toxic pesticides as a last resort, IPM offers a comprehensive framework for managing pests while minimizing environmental impact.

Termite Control Strategies:
Termites pose a unique threat to homes, as they can silently undermine structural integrity over time. We’ll discuss effective termite control strategies, including soil treatments, baiting systems, and wood treatments. By creating a protective barrier around your home and targeting termite colonies at their source, you can prevent costly damage and preserve the longevity of your property.
